Find information, coupons, menus, ratings and contact details for restaurants in Cottonwood Shores, Texas
4823 W Fm 2147, Cottonwood Shores, Texas, 78657
International
4401 Cottonwood Drive, Cottonwood Shores, Texas, 78657
Italian
Unfortunately, no restaurants meet your search criteria.